Rediscover Your Career as a Data Administrator with NetApp NCDA NS0-163 Certification

In the labyrinthine world of modern data management, the role of a data administrator has become increasingly pivotal. With the proliferation of enterprise applications and the exponential growth of information, organizations are compelled to adopt sophisticated storage solutions that transcend the limitations of local disks. NetApp has emerged as a venerated name in this domain, providing robust solutions that facilitate high availability, resilience, and efficiency in data management. Among the various certifications offered by NetApp, the NCDA NS0-163 credential holds a distinct place, serving as a foundational benchmark for aspiring professionals who aim to master enterprise storage administration.

The essence of this certification lies in its ability to impart a deep, practical understanding of NetApp’s Data ONTAP operating system. This system, renowned for its versatility and robustness, allows administrators to manage network-attached storage and storage area networks with dexterity. The NS0-163 exam evaluates a candidate’s ability to navigate these systems, configure storage controllers, and implement protocols such as NFS, CIFS, and iSCSI, ensuring data is accessible, secure, and recoverable in dynamic enterprise environments. The certification does not merely validate theoretical knowledge; it is a testament to practical acumen and the capability to manage real-world storage solutions efficiently.

Who Should Pursue NCDA NS0-163 and Prerequisites for Success

The NetApp NCDA NS0-163 certification is tailored for professionals seeking to establish a solid foundation in enterprise storage administration. It is particularly suitable for individuals responsible for managing multiprotocol storage systems and complex networked environments. Administrators who routinely work with NFS, CIFS, or iSCSI protocols on NetApp appliances will find this certification invaluable, as it consolidates practical knowledge and operational skills that are crucial for managing large-scale data centers. The certification also serves those who aspire to expand their career horizons, bridging the gap between basic storage knowledge and advanced administration capabilities.

Candidates considering the NCDA NS0-163 credential are expected to possess hands-on experience in implementing and administering NetApp storage solutions. Typically, six to twelve months of direct exposure to multiprotocol environments is advisable, providing the foundation necessary to understand the intricacies of enterprise storage. Familiarity with high-availability configurations is essential, as these ensure that systems remain operational during maintenance or unexpected failures. Administrators must also be comfortable with technologies such as SyncMirror, which facilitates rapid data recovery, and other ONTAP solutions that employ single-node or multi-node architectures.

Understanding the prerequisites is not merely a matter of meeting eligibility criteria; it is an essential preparation step that shapes the effectiveness of training and examination performance. Practical experience allows candidates to contextualize theoretical knowledge, turning abstract concepts into actionable skills. For example, configuring disk shelves or fiber-channel networking requires a nuanced understanding of both the hardware infrastructure and the software mechanisms controlling it. Those without direct exposure may struggle to grasp the operational dynamics, which is why pre-certification experience is strongly recommended.

Preparing for the Exam and Leveraging Certification

The NetApp NCDA NS0-163 certification is a pivotal credential for professionals seeking to establish mastery over enterprise storage administration. Achieving this certification demands a thorough understanding of the Data ONTAP operating system, the ability to navigate NFS and CIFS protocols, and proficiency in managing multiprotocol storage environments. The preparation process involves immersive learning experiences, practical exercises, and a disciplined approach to mastering core competencies. Candidates who engage deeply with the curriculum develop not only technical proficiency but also operational intuition, enabling them to perform administrative tasks with confidence and precision.

Effective preparation for the NCDA exam begins with understanding the scope of knowledge required. Administrators must be comfortable with storage architecture, volume and aggregate management, logical unit number creation, and high-availability configurations. Hands-on familiarity with configuring storage controllers, managing disk shelves, and integrating fiber-channel networks is critical. Training emphasizes practical exercises that replicate real-world scenarios, allowing candidates to internalize the skills necessary for managing enterprise storage systems efficiently.

Scenario-based exercises are central to NCDA preparation. Candidates engage with situations that mirror operational challenges, such as performance bottlenecks, disk failures, protocol conflicts, and data recovery tasks. These exercises foster analytical thinking and problem-solving skills, enabling professionals to identify root causes, implement corrective measures, and optimize system performance. The experiential learning approach ensures that knowledge gained is not merely theoretical but applicable in professional contexts where swift and accurate decision-making is required.

The curriculum also emphasizes disaster recovery and data protection. Administrators learn to implement SnapMirror, SyncMirror, and other replication technologies that ensure rapid recovery in case of hardware or software failures. Candidates are trained to develop comprehensive backup strategies, manage snapshots, and configure failover mechanisms that maintain high system availability. This practical expertise is indispensable in enterprise environments where uninterrupted access to data is critical, and where downtime can result in significant operational or financial consequences.
